Santa's Hot Chocolate Bar Recipe

Rich, smooth hot chocolate made with grated semi-sweet chocolate, sugar, and milk, finished with vanilla. Serve from a thermos with an assortment of toppings including whipped cream, marshmallows, candy canes, chocolate chips, caramel and chocolate sauces, and flavored syrups for a customizable holiday drink station.
Ingredients

- ¼ teaspoon salt
- ⅝ cup water, boiling
- 1 cup sugar
- 1 ½ teaspoons vanilla extract
- fresh whipped cream(optional)
- mini chocolate chips(optional)
- caramel sauce(optional)
- chocolate sauce(optional)
- marshmallows, mini and large(optional)
- candy canes(optional)
- flavored syrups, assorted(optional)
Instructions
- 1
Combine grated chocolate, sugar, and salt in a large saucepan.
- 2
Add boiling water and stir until combined.
- 3
Bring the mixture to a boil.
- 4
Add milk and heat until hot but not boiling.
- 5
Stir in vanilla extract.
- 6
Pour into thermos or carafe and mugs.
- 7
Garnish each serving with desired assorted condiments.
Tips
Use a thermos to keep chocolate hot for extended serving
Set up condiments in small bowls for easy self-service
Good to Know
Hot chocolate base can be refrigerated in an airtight container for up to 3 days; reheat gently before serving.
Prepare hot chocolate base up to 2 hours ahead; keep warm in thermos or reheat gently just before serving. Arrange condiments in advance.
Serve hot, garnished with desired toppings. Ideal for holiday gatherings, winter parties, or Christmas morning.
Common Mistakes
Do not boil the milk mixture to avoid scalding and developing a cooked flavor
Stir chocolate mixture thoroughly when adding boiling water to avoid lumps
